Enable job alerts via email!

Staff Software Engineer, Full-Stack

Rivian and Volkswagen Group Technologies

Palo Alto (CA)

On-site

USD 186,000 - 233,000

Full time

8 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Rivian and Volkswagen Group Technologies seeks a senior technical leader for their Quality Management Software team. The role involves guiding engineers in building innovative software solutions, prioritizing quality and performance across various applications. Ideal candidates will have extensive experience in full-stack development and a passion for mentoring others.

Benefits

Robust medical/Rx, dental, and vision insurance
Coverage effective on first day of employment

Qualifications

  • 10+ years of experience in software development.
  • Expertise in full-stack application design and deployment.
  • Strong understanding of modern JavaScript frameworks and backend programming.

Responsibilities

  • Provide technical leadership and guidance to engineers.
  • Design and architect complex software systems.
  • Mentor and coach other engineers.

Skills

JavaScript
Node.js
Python
HTML
CSS
React
Vue
Kubernetes
SQL
NoSQL

Job description

About Us

Rivian and Volkswagen Group Technologies is a joint venture between two industry leaders with a clear vision for automotive’s next chapter. From operating systems to zonal controllers to cloud and connectivity solutions, we’re addressing the challenges of electric vehicles through technology that will set the standards for software-defined vehicles around the world.

The road to the future is uncharted. By combining our expertise across connectivity, AI, security and more, we’ll map a new way forward. Working together, we’ll create a future that’s more connected, more intelligent, more sustainable for everyone.


Role Summary

The Quality Management Software team at Rivian exists to design, develop & maintain a suite of applications that enable product quality throughout its lifecycle. Our team builds and operates the critical systems and tools for the end-to-end quality experience from edge to cloud that integrate across multiple verticals (manufacturing, service, etc).


Responsibilities

  • Technical Leadership: Provide technical leadership and guidance to a team of engineers, driving architectural decisions and ensuring the quality of the team's output.
  • System Design: Design and architect complex software systems, considering scalability, performance, security, and maintainability.
  • Mentorship and Collaboration: Mentor and coach other engineers, fostering a culture of collaboration and knowledge sharing.
  • Problem Solving: Tackle complex technical challenges and provide innovative solutions to overcome obstacles.
  • Code Quality: Champion code quality standards and best practices, conducting code reviews and ensuring the team's code is well-documented and testable.
  • Performance Optimization: Identify and address performance bottlenecks in applications and systems, optimizing for speed and efficiency.
  • Innovation: Stay abreast of the latest technologies and trends in full-stack development, exploring new tools and techniques to improve the team's productivity and the quality of the software.
  • Communication: Communicate effectively with technical and non-technical stakeholders, clearly articulating technical concepts and decisions.
  • Ownership: Take ownership of projects and initiatives, driving them to successful completion.

Qualifications

  • Experience: 10+ years of professional software development experience with a proven track record of designing, building, and deploying complex full-stack applications.
  • Technical Skills:
    • Frontend: Deep expertise in modern JavaScript frameworks (React, Vue), HTML, CSS, and responsive design. Extensive experience with state management, performance optimization, and testing frameworks. Experience developing with Three.js is a plus
    • Backend: Mastery of at least one backend language (Node.js, Python) and extensive experience building highly scalable and reliable RESTful APIs. Strong understanding of microservices architecture and design patterns.
    • Databases: In-depth knowledge of various database technologies (SQL, NoSQL, graph databases) and experience with data modeling, performance tuning, and database administration.
    • Cloud: Extensive experience with cloud platforms (AWS, Azure, GCP), including serverless computing, container orchestration (Kubernetes), and infrastructure as code.
    • DevOps: Strong understanding of CI/CD pipelines, automated testing, and monitoring tools.
    • Security: Knowledge of security best practices for web applications and APIs, including authentication, authorization, and data protection.
    • Agile: Deep understanding of Agile development methodologies and experience working in Agile environments.

Pay Disclosure

Salary Range/Hourly Rate for California Based Applicants: 186,000 to 232,500 (actual compensation will be determined based on experience, location, and other factors permitted by law).

Benefits Summary: Rivian and Volkswagen Group Technologies provides robust medical/Rx, dental and vision insurance packages for full-time employees, their spouse or domestic partner, and children up to age 26. Coverage is effective on the first day of employment.




Equal Opportunity

Rivian and Volkswagen Group Technologies is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, ancestry, sex, sexual orientation, gender, gender expression, gender identity, genetic information or characteristics, physical or mental disability, marital/domestic partner status, age, military/veteran status, medical condition, or any other characteristic protected by law. We are also committed to ensuring compliance with all applicable fair employment practice laws regarding citizenship and immigration status.

Rivian and Volkswagen Group Technologies is committed to ensuring that our hiring process is accessible for persons with disabilities. If you have a disability or limitation, such as those covered by the Americans with Disabilities Act, that requires accommodations to assist you in the search and application process, please email us atcandidateaccommodations@rivian.com.

Candidate Data Privacy

Rivian and VW Group Technologies (“Rivian and Volkswagen Group Technologies”) may collect, use and disclose your personal information or personal data (within the meaning of the applicable data protection laws) when you apply for employment and/or participate in our recruitment processes (“Candidate Personal Data”). This data includes contact, demographic, communications, educational, professional, employment, social media/website, network/device, recruiting system usage/interaction, security and preference information. Rivian and Volkswagen Group Technologies may use your Candidate Personal Data for the purposes of (i) tracking interactions with our recruiting system; (ii) carrying out, analyzing and improving our application and recruitment process, including assessing you and your application and conducting employment, background and reference checks; (iii) establishing an employment relationship or entering into an employment contract with you; (iv) complying with our legal, regulatory and corporate governance obligations; (v) recordkeeping; (vi) ensuring network and information security and preventing fraud; and (vii) as otherwise required or permitted by applicable law.

Rivian and Volkswagen Group Technologies may share your Candidate Personal Data with (i) internal personnel who have a need to know such information in order to perform their duties, including individuals on our People Team, Finance, Legal, and the team(s) with the position(s) for which you are applying; (ii) Rivian and Volkswagen Group Technologies affiliates; and (iii) Rivian and Volkswagen Group Technologies’ service providers, including providers of background checks, staffing services, and cloud services.

Rivian and Volkswagen Group Technologies may transfer or store internationally your Candidate Personal Data, including to or in the United States, Canada, and the European Union and in the cloud, and this data may be subject to the laws and accessible to the courts, law enforcement and national security authorities of such jurisdictions.

Please see our Candidate Data Privacy Notice (English) andCandidate Data Privacy Notice (Serbian)for more information.

Please note that we are currently not accepting applications from third party application services.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Staff Software Engineer, Full-Stack

Slope

Palo Alto

Remote

USD 190,000 - 230,000

Yesterday
Be an early applicant

Staff Software Engineer, Full Stack

SmarterDx

Remote

USD 220,000 - 270,000

4 days ago
Be an early applicant

Staff Software Engineer, Full-Stack

Owner

Remote

USD 190,000 - 230,000

5 days ago
Be an early applicant

Senior Software Engineer, Full-Stack

Slope

Palo Alto

Remote

USD 170,000 - 200,000

Yesterday
Be an early applicant

Staff Software Engineer, Full Stack (Agent Experience)

Affirm

Remote

USD 200,000 - 275,000

13 days ago

Full Stack Software Engineer

併牡

San Francisco

Remote

USD 139,000 - 203,000

2 days ago
Be an early applicant

Staff Full-Stack Software Engineer

Recruiting From Scratch

San Francisco

Remote

USD 215,000 - 250,000

5 days ago
Be an early applicant

Staff Software Engineer, Full Stack

Headspace

San Francisco

Hybrid

USD 140,000 - 225,000

5 days ago
Be an early applicant

Fullstack Engineer

Recruiting From Scratch

San Francisco

Remote

USD 140,000 - 230,000

4 days ago
Be an early applicant